Transport options to and around Oldtown Salinas
Fly into Salinas, CA (SNS-Salinas Municipal), the closest airport, located 2.2 mi (3.6 km) from the city centre. If you're unable to find a flight that fits your schedule, you could book a flight to Monterey, CA (MRY-Monterey Peninsula), which is 12.2 mi (19.6 km) away.
If you'd rather travel by train, you can make your way to Salinas Station.
